How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Verified reviewBooked this Guest House on recommendations we read on Booking.com. We weren't disappointed Patrick was an Amazing host from the moment we arrived. Nothing was to much trouble and he gave us lots of information about the area and restaurants etc The Guest House was wonderful the rooms spacious everything was very clean with tea coffee provided. It is situated in a quiet area only a short walk to both the Old Cite and the town with a square that has lots of restaurants around it so the location is ideal to enjoy both. The lovely Breakfast served by Patrick was on the terrace with incredible views of the castle which makes an excellent start to your day. We thoroughly enjoyed our 5 nights stay here and definitely recommend it if visiting Carcassonne.
